Arsenal Roma talks over Ainsley Maitland-Niles hit £4.2m snag – report
Arsenal midfielder Ainsley Maitland-Niles looks set to leave the Emirates Stadium in the January transfer window.
It looked as though the Gunners ace was Roma-bound.
Earlier this week, it was reported that the Maitland-Niles said yes to joining the Serie A side on an initial loan deal.

The terms would potentially leave the door open to a permanent move to the Italian capital in the summer.
And it seemed that Maitland-Niles was ready to complete the switch to Jose Mourinho’s side.
However, has now reported that talks have hit a stumbling block.
Arsenal will apparently only part company with Maitland-Niles on a loan deal with obligation to buy.
In addition, the Gunners reportedly won’t settle for less than 15m euro (£12.6m).
Meanwhile, Roma are apparently only willing to pay 10m euro (£8.4m) – a difference of £4.2m.
Wwhile the Giallorossi remain optimistic, this snag has curbed Tiago Pinto’s enthusiasm, added the report.
In addition, Arsenal could risk missing out on doing a deal with Roma.
The Italians have apparently got a Plan B in Eintracht Frankfurt’s Almamy Toure.
That said, several Premier League clubs are reportedly eyeing Maitland-Niles too.
So if the Roma deal falls through, Arsenal appear to have other options.
